Teju Ajani is a global technology executive and a Software Engineer. She recently served as the Managing Director (Nigeria) for Apple Inc. [1] She was Apple Inc's first African top-executive employee in Africa [2] and the first woman in that role. [3]
The technology expert has work experience with BEA Systems, VMware, Oracle, Google [4] and Apple and is recognized as one of the most influential women in technology by various organizations, [5] [6] and a frequently featured speaker across technology and media circles. [7]
Born in Nigeria, she attended Federal Government Girls College, Sagamu and holds a Bachelor of Science (BS) in Economics [8] and a Master of Science in Software Engineering (MSSE) from Golden Gate University in San Francisco. [8]
She also has various certificates in Startup Management from Stanford University Pragmatic Institute, and Google respectively. [8]
Ajani worked as a software engineer at Vovida networks in California. [9] She joined BEA systems and worked as a Developer Relations Engineer and as a systems engineer in her early career. [8] She switched paths and worked as a senior customer programs manager at VMware. [8]
In 2011, she served as a principal product manager at Oracle before joining Google in 2012 as its business development manager in Nigeria. [8] In 2014, she joined YouTube as its head of content partnerships for Sub-Saharan Africa. [10] And in 2018 she assumed the role of country manager for Android partnerships for Google. [8] She was appointed managing director of Apple in Nigeria in 2021.
She is an advocate for women in leadership and technology, and an active investor and advisor in Startup circles.
